Output 7e6453f44ffd94dea4f6ff992e8fdc976a9b4a84d31898f8b7c1aac578488935:1

value
129000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af021f90e0644ad1d4fcbaf8d53cdf373fc6baa OP_EQUAL
address
3Cu42fEYtgkY92c3Yo74c4jRVY93iY1QuT
transaction
7e6453f44ffd94dea4f6ff992e8fdc976a9b4a84d31898f8b7c1aac578488935
confirmations
308940
spent
true